Top Unconventional Travel Destinations
Here are some of the top unconventional travel destinations for thrifty explorers:
- Tana Toraja, Indonesia - a remote region known for its unique culture and stunning natural beauty
- Hidden Beach, Mexico - a secluded beach only accessible by boat
- Hang Son Doong, Vietnam - the world's largest cave
- Trolltunga, Norway - a challenging hike with breathtaking views
- Tsingy de Bemaraha, Madagascar - a unique limestone forest
Tips for Visiting Unconventional Travel Destinations
Visiting unconventional travel destinations requires more planning and research than traditional tourist spots. Here are some tips to keep in mind:
- Research, research, research - learn as much as you can about the destination and its culture
- Be respectful - remember that you are a guest in someone else's home
- Be prepared - pack accordingly and plan for unexpected challenges
- Stay flexible - things don't always go as planned, so be prepared to adapt
